Timberleaf Trailers
When Kevin Molick outgrew his manufacturing facility in Denver a few years ago, Front Range real estate costs presented a major hurdle for the fast-growing teardrop trailer business. So, Kevin and his wife uprooted from their home of 40 years and moved to the Grand Valley. Today, Timberleaf Trailers is on the move again. Having outgrown their original Grand Junction facility, they are building a new 9,500 sq.ft. facility from scratch.
